Handover Note — Merrowvale Term Sheet

From outgoing to incoming director. Status: Merrowvale Holdings sent a revised term sheet last week. Key points: three-year exclusivity in the Ostrand region, 12% revenue share, co-branding rights on the Lanterna line. Our counter on exclusivity scope is pending. Legal has flagged the termination clause; needs tightening. Sales leads should hold all Ostrand prospecting until resolved. Next call is scheduled for Thursday. Deal context is noted confidentially below.

management briefing: Project Ulavan slips by two quarters because of the staffing delay.

**Troubleshooting: Consent banner not rendering on Lorriganware checkout pages**

Context for the weekly eng sync: the Tapefern consent banner rollout hit 60% of traffic before reports of blank banners on checkout. Root cause so far: the consent-config service returns a 403 when the region header is missing, and the banner script swallows the error. Workaround: pin clients to config schema v3 until the fallback lands. To reproduce, call the consent-config staging endpoint with a missing region header, authenticating with the credential below.

login token, bagug-kafop: eyJhbGciOiJIUzI1NiIsInR5cCI6IkpXVCJ9.eyJzdWIiOiIcMLov2In0.Z5RLDIfp

## Changelog — Quillbus 4.2

Heads up for security review: we flipped the default log compaction mode from time-based to key-based on all Quillbus broker tiers. Tombstones now get purged after the retention window closes, so deleted records genuinely disappear instead of lingering in old segments. That's a win for data-minimization, but it does mean forensic replay of compacted topics is shorter than before. Nothing else changed in the auth path. The broker defaults now ship as follows.

config for bawig-fadup:
[zorix]
host = zorix.lumicworks.corp
user = zorix_svc
database = zorix_prod